Yet, we also believe that to apply it to real-world, enterprise use cases there is still a ... bandolero swan 77WebYou can combine multiple queries using the set operators UNION, UNION ALL, INTERSECT, and MINUS. All set operators have equal precedence. If a SQL statement contains multiple set operators, then Oracle Database evaluates them from the left to right unless parentheses explicitly specify another order.
